GENUS: Humulus

SPECIES: lupulus

CULTIVAR: Wuerttemberger

PEDIGREE: no information

PRIMARY SITE: USDA/OSU Hop Research Farm, Corvallis, OR.

ORIGIN: Hop Union USA, Yakima WA (Dr. Greg Lewis) who had obtained it from Germany

DATE RECEIVED: Spring 1993

METHOD RECEIVED: rhizomes

AVAILBILITY: no restrictions

REFERENCES: Annual Repoprt of Hop Research, USDA/ARS 1993 and later years

MATURITY: medium early

LEAF COLOR: light green

SEX: female

DISEASES: Downy mildew: moderately resdistant

Powdery mildew: No information

Verticillium wilt. Tolerant

Viruses: No information

VIGOR: fair to good

YIELD: poor

SIDE ARM LENGTH: 12 to 30 inches

ALPHA ACIDS: 5 %

BETA ACIDS: 4 %

COHUMULONE: 28 %

STORAGE STABILITY: good, retained about 72% of its original alpha acids after 6 months room temperature storage

OIL: 1.25 ml/ 100 g. Humulene18%; caryophyllene 6%; farnesene 4%; myrcene 59%. H/C ratio = 3.00

MAJOR TRAITS: pleasant continental aroma characteristics

OTHER INFORMATION: This is an old German hop which no longer is grown commercially. It may be related to Tettnanger of Saazer.
